EMERGENCY CHILD CARE FIRST AID / CPR LEVEL B
This 9 hour course includes choking skills, breathing emergencies and CPR for babies and children. The course also covers basic first aid for common injuries such as bleeding, burns, falls, fractures, poisons and some medical conditions. AED certification is also included.
The Emergency Child Care First Aid course is recommended for child care workers, preschool and elementary school teachers, daycare staff and new parents.
This course meets legislation requirements for provincial/territorial early childhood education and daycare worker safety requirements. Red Cross 3 year certification issued upon successful completion.
